#8d2005 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8d2005 is composed of 55.3% red, 12.5%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 77.3% magenta, 96.5%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 11.9 degrees, a saturation of 93.2% and a lightness of 28.6%. #8d2005 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ff400a with #1b0000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

#8d2005 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8d2005 has RGB values of R:141, G:32, B:5 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.77, Y:0.96,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 9248773.
